Climate change is primarily driven by human activities that increase concentrations of greenhouse gases (GHGs) in the atmosphere. Here are the key factors contributing to climate change:
-
Burning of Fossil Fuels: The combustion of coal, oil, and natural gas for energy and transportation releases large amounts of carbon dioxide (CO2) and other GHGs into the atmosphere.
-
Deforestation: Trees absorb CO2, so when forests are cut down or burned, the carbon stored in trees is released, and the capacity of the earth to absorb CO2 is reduced.
-
Industrial Processes: Various industrial activities release GHGs, including emissions from chemical production, cement manufacturing, and other processes.
-
Agriculture: Agricultural practices contribute to climate change through methane emissions from livestock and rice paddies, as well as nitrous oxide from fertilized soils.
-
Waste Management: Landfills produce methane as organic waste decomposes anaerobically (without oxygen).
-
Land Use Changes: Urbanization and changes in land use can disrupt natural carbon sinks, contributing to increases in atmospheric CO2.
-
Increased Energy Demand: As global population and energy consumption grow, particularly in developing countries, the demand for fossil fuels rises, leading to more emissions.
The accumulation of GHGs in the atmosphere enhances the greenhouse effect, trapping heat and leading to global warming, which causes changes in climate patterns, including more severe weather events, rising sea levels, and shifts in ecosystems.
In summary, human activities, particularly those related to energy, land use, and industrial processes, are the primary drivers of climate change. Addressing climate change requires reducing GHG emissions, transitioning to clean energy sources, and adopting sustainable practices.
